Home
last modified time | relevance | path

Searched refs:getTLSControl (Results 1 – 13 of 13) sorted by relevance

/dports/cad/sumo/sumo-1.2.0/src/netload/
H A DNLDiscreteEventBuilder.cpp95 const std::vector<std::string> ids = myNet.getTLSControl().getAllTLIds(); in buildSaveTLStateCommand()
97 const MSTLLogicControl::TLSLogicVariants& logics = myNet.getTLSControl().get(*tls); in buildSaveTLStateCommand()
102 if (!myNet.getTLSControl().knows(source)) { in buildSaveTLStateCommand()
105 const MSTLLogicControl::TLSLogicVariants& logics = myNet.getTLSControl().get(source); in buildSaveTLStateCommand()
123 const std::vector<std::string> ids = myNet.getTLSControl().getAllTLIds(); in buildSaveTLSwitchesCommand()
125 const MSTLLogicControl::TLSLogicVariants& logics = myNet.getTLSControl().get(*tls); in buildSaveTLSwitchesCommand()
130 if (!myNet.getTLSControl().knows(source)) { in buildSaveTLSwitchesCommand()
133 const MSTLLogicControl::TLSLogicVariants& logics = myNet.getTLSControl().get(source); in buildSaveTLSwitchesCommand()
151 const std::vector<std::string> ids = myNet.getTLSControl().getAllTLIds(); in buildSaveTLSwitchStatesCommand()
158 if (!myNet.getTLSControl().knows(source)) { in buildSaveTLSwitchStatesCommand()
[all …]
H A DNLBuilder.cpp212 myNet.getTLSControl().switchOffAll(); in build()
H A DNLJunctionControlBuilder.cpp471 return myNet.getTLSControl(); in getTLLogicControlToUse()
/dports/cad/sumo/sumo-1.2.0/src/libsumo/
H A DTrafficLight.cpp48 return MSNet::getInstance()->getTLSControl().getAllTLIds(); in getIDList()
169 getTLS(tlsID).setStateInstantiatingOnline(MSNet::getInstance()->getTLSControl(), state); in setRedYellowGreenState()
182 active->changeStepAndDuration(MSNet::getInstance()->getTLSControl(), cTime, index, duration); in setPhase()
195 getTLS(tlsID).switchTo(MSNet::getInstance()->getTLSControl(), programID); in setProgram()
207 …active->changeStepAndDuration(MSNet::getInstance()->getTLSControl(), cTime, index, TIME2STEPS(phas… in setPhaseDuration()
223 …tLogic* mslogic = new MSSimpleTrafficLightLogic(MSNet::getInstance()->getTLSControl(), tlsID, logi… in setCompleteRedYellowGreenDefinition()
242 if (!MSNet::getInstance()->getTLSControl().knows(id)) { in LIBSUMO_SUBSCRIPTION_IMPLEMENTATION()
245 return MSNet::getInstance()->getTLSControl().get(id); in LIBSUMO_SUBSCRIPTION_IMPLEMENTATION()
/dports/cad/sumo/sumo-1.2.0/src/microsim/output/
H A DMSFullExport.cpp118 MSTLLogicControl& vc = MSNet::getInstance()->getTLSControl(); in writeTLS()
121 … MSTLLogicControl::TLSLogicVariants& vars = MSNet::getInstance()->getTLSControl().get(*id_it); in writeTLS()
/dports/cad/sumo/sumo-1.2.0/src/guisim/
H A DGUITrafficLightLogicWrapper.cpp175 … (&MSNet::getInstance()->getTLSControl(), &MSTLLogicControl::getPhaseDef, myTLLogic.getID())); in begin2TrackPhases()
243 if (!MSNet::getInstance()->getTLSControl().isActive(&myTLLogic)) { in drawGL()
H A DGUIJunctionWrapper.cpp175 … const MSTrafficLightLogic* active = MSNet::getInstance()->getTLSControl().getActive(myTLLID); in drawGL()
H A DGUINet.cpp140 const std::vector<MSTrafficLightLogic*>& logics = getTLSControl().getAllLogics(); in initTLMap()
285 for (const auto tls : getTLSControl().getAllLogics()) { in initGUIStructures()
/dports/cad/sumo/sumo-1.2.0/src/traci-server/
H A DTraCIServerAPI_TrafficLight.cpp130 if (!MSNet::getInstance()->getTLSControl().knows(id)) { in processGet()
133 … MSTrafficLightLogic* tls = MSNet::getInstance()->getTLSControl().get(id).getActive(); in processGet()
/dports/cad/sumo/sumo-1.2.0/src/microsim/
H A DMSNet.h406 MSTLLogicControl& getTLSControl() { in getTLSControl() function
/dports/cad/sumo/sumo-1.2.0/src/osgview/
H A DGUIOSGBuilder.cpp101 const std::vector<std::string> tlids = net->getTLSControl().getAllTLIds(); in buildOSGScene()
103 MSTLLogicControl::TLSLogicVariants& vars = net->getTLSControl().get(*i); in buildOSGScene()
H A DGUIOSGView.cpp313 …MSTLLogicControl::TLSLogicVariants& vars = net->getTLSControl().get(d.filename.substr(3, linkStrin… in onPaint()
553 MSTLLogicControl& tlsControl = MSNet::getInstance()->getTLSControl(); in onGamingClick()
/dports/cad/sumo/sumo-1.2.0/src/gui/
H A DGUIViewTraffic.cpp339 MSTLLogicControl& tlsControl = MSNet::getInstance()->getTLSControl(); in onGamingClick()